While there is no maximum age restriction, the minimum age to rent a car in Canada is 21. Drivers 21-24 will have to pay an additional fee that can range from $5 – $25 (CAD) per day. There are no maximum age restrictions when renting a car in Canada.
Can you rent a car over the age of 75 in Canada?
There are no maximum age limits in Canada, however, it is recommended to always check the terms and conditions of your rental. Restrictions on the size and type of vehicles may apply to renters between 21- 24 years old.

Can a 75 year old rent a car in Germany?
In most of Europe, there is no car rental age limit for drivers over the age of 65. Germany, France, Spain and the United Kingdom all have all car rental over 80 years old.
Can you rent a car in the US if you are over 70?
Most rental companies in the USA do not have maximum limits on car rentals. And while age limits may vary between car rental companies, senior drivers age 70 and older are encouraged to call or contact the rental location directly to find out what the age limits are.

Can an 80 year old hire a car in Australia?
Maximum Age
From all Hertz locations in Australia, there is no set maximum driving age, however, a medical certificate is recommended from drivers over 75. Ultimately, it is the location’s decision if they will rent to a person over the age of 75.
Can you rent a car in Europe if you are over 75?
Maximum Car Rental Age Limits
Many countries in Europe don’t impose maximum age limits on car rental. These include Austria, Belgium, Bulgaria, Croatia, Estonia, Finland, France, Germany, Hungary, Iceland, Italy, Latvia, Luxembourg, Netherlands, Norway, Portugal, Slovenia, Spain, Sweden, and Switzerland.
Can an 80 year old rent a car in Greece?
Although the legal driving age in Greece is 21, many rental providers have a driver age bracket of 25 to 70. So if you’re over 70, or under 25 and over 21, you might have to pay an additional surcharge for driving a car in Greece. Car hire excess insurance may also be required if you’re below 25 or above 69.
Can you rent a car in Canada with a US license?
You can use your U.S. drivers’ license in Canada.
Your U.S. drivers’ license is acceptable when renting a car in Canada. You will not need an International Driving Permit (IDP). However, you should apply for the IDP if you travel often to countries where English is not one of the official languages.
Can an 80 year old rent a car in Italy?
Generally, rental car companies in Italy require you to be 21 or over and no older than the maximum age (usually 70-75 years). All drivers must present a valid driver’s license, an ID as proof of their identity, and a credit card to make the payment.

Can a 76 year old hire a car in Ireland?
You will need a valid licence and credit card to rent a vehicle in Ireland. Most rental companies will not rent to drivers under 25 but there is no upper age limit.

Is there an upper age limit for car hire in New Zealand?
While a maximum age restriction is not a feature of most car or campervan rental companies in New Zealand, always check the “Terms & Conditions” of car rental companies to make sure. At the time of writing, the only known companies to apply an upper age limit is Apollo Campers and Hertz.

Can you rent a car in Italy if you are over 70?
Minimum age for renting a car in Italy
In Italy, the minimum legal driving age is 18; however, most car rentals rent cars only to drivers 21 years old or more. Drivers under 25 or over 70 may incur additional insurance costs: ask each provider for details.
